Product Description

Zinc Plated Rubber Lined Pipe Clamps are versatile pipe support and hanger systems designed to securely suspend, support, and protect pipes, tubes, and conduits from overhead structures. These clamps feature a durable zinc-plated steel housing with an integrated cushioned rubber lining, combining mechanical strength with superior vibration isolation and surface protection. They are commonly referred to as "pipe hangers," "saddle clamps," or "suspension clamps" in plumbing, HVAC, and industrial applications.

Features of rubber line pipe clamp

1. Material Composition

Outer Housing: Fabricated from carbon steel (mild steel) with an electro-galvanized zinc coating (typically 8-12 microns). The zinc plating provides corrosion resistance and a clean metallic finish.

Rubber Lining: A black synthetic rubber insert (commonly EPDM, Neoprene, or Nitrile) is precision-molded or bonded to the inner circumference. This lining is engineered for durability, UV resistance (for indoor/outdoor use), and chemical resilience.

Fastening Components: Usually include a zinc-plated threaded rod, bolt, or J-hook for overhead suspension, along with matching nuts and washers.

2. Structural Design

Two-Piece or Single-Piece Construction: Most designs consist of:

Top Half: A U-shaped or saddle-shaped bracket with integrated hanging point (hole for rod/bolt).

Bottom Half: A matching saddle or retaining plate.

Hinge & Bolt Mechanism: A hinged connection on one side and a bolted closure on the other, allowing the clamp to fully encircle the pipe.

Full-Circle Encasement: Unlike U-clamps, these typically form a complete 360-degree ring around the pipe when installed, providing uniform support and restraint.

Rubber Lining Profile: The rubber insert often features ribbed, grooved, or contoured patterns to enhance grip and allow for thermal expansion/contraction.

Applications of rubber lined pipe clamp

Plumbing Systems: Suspending water supply lines, drain pipes, and vent stacks in commercial/residential buildings.

HVAC & Refrigeration: Supporting copper refrigerant lines, chilled water pipes, and condensate drains.

Fire Protection: Installing sprinkler system piping (with appropriate certifications).

Industrial Piping: Supporting process lines in manufacturing plants (non-critical services).

Electrical Conduit Support: Securing rigid or intermediate metal conduit (EMT/IMC).

Solar Thermal Systems: Mounting solar hot water piping on roofs and structures.

FAQ of Rubber Lined Pipe Clamp:

Q: Does the rubber lining comply with sound insulation standards?

A: Yes, our pipe clamps use high-quality EPDM rubber liners that meet DIN 4109 standards for acoustic insulation, effectively reducing noise transmission through the building structure.

Q: What is the benefit of the combination M8/M10 nut?

A: The dual-threaded nut allows the clamp to be used with both M8 and M10 threaded rods, providing maximum flexibility for installers on the job site.

Q: Is the rubber lining resistant to UV and aging?

A: Our EPDM liners are highly resistant to aging, ozone, and weather, ensuring they remain flexible and effective for vibration damping over a long service life.
